Dan/W4NTI No an N call 1x3 does not mean that he is necessarily a recent Extra. I pass my Tech with code in May of 1992 and received my original call sign (N8UZE) at that time, which I have kept. In late 1992, I passed my Extra, including 20wpm, and received my Extra class license in early 1993. The sequentially assigned 1x3 calls beginning with N ran out in the early to mid 1990s, the exact date being dependent on the call area. One cannot leap to conclusions based on call sign. Dee D. : The French have been waitng for some time for a government minister to sign the rule change abolishing their code test. It was signed on the 4th, and will take effect when published in the official journal, probably either on the 14th or 21st of May, 2004. Yep ! It's done for 24 hours from now.
